    We are looking for help with Volunteer Income Tax Assistance (VITA) Program.

    We run a VITA site in conjunction with the IRS and the United Way of Greater Richmond and Petersburg. Tax clients can choose between drop-off/virtual or in-person appointments. This program is a vital service to residents of Greater Fulton and East Henrico. We had 153 accepted tax returns in our 2025 tax season, returning $150,000 in refunds to our tax clients.

    Our available opportunities are:

    • Screener/Intake: Welcomes all clients, reviews tax documents, and will scan documents for drop off/virtual appointments.
      • In-person only with late afternoon/evening Tuesday/Thursday shifts and/or one Saturday morning each month during tax season
    • Basic & Advanced Tax Preparers: Prepares returns based on the documentation that is provided by tax clients using the online tax software that's provisioned to us by the IRS.
      • Virtual or in-person options. In-person shifts are usually one day a week from late afternoon to early evening and/or one Saturday morning each month. Virtual preparation is fully flexible and is based entirely on your schedule.

    Timeframe: Mid-February to April 15, 2026

    Experience: No tax experience is required! All roles must know how to use a computer and email. Screener/intake volunteers must also be able to be trained to use a scanner.

    Training: Training is available through the United Way of Greater Richmond and Petersburg. We can also provide in-person or virtual training. The ability to pass online IRS virtual testing is required to serve in any role. The length of testing depends on the role. A hard copy of the test as well as all materials are provided to you by the NRC, thanks to the United Way of Greater Richmond and Petersburg.

    We require the completion of a virtual volunteer orientation via Google Meet and a visit to our center to complete a volunteer application before volunteering for your first shift. Virtual volunteers must also bring their laptops to our building for a device security check.
